Hi Rob! Thanks for your kind words!IeMS wrote:Sub @ ibloo - If this question has already been asked forgive me as there are 9 pages of comments to read through. I am curious if this works with all resolutions? IE - the resolution on my computer is 1600x900 widescreen. Should I set the paginate to horizontal, and someone with a 19" or even 17" screen views the website, will the bookparks be off? Or is that the purpose of this extension - to avoid this possible issue? Just curious. Thank you for your time.
I love your wesite btw. Very cool.
My personal opinion on what your requiring is this...
I would create your layout with a width area of 1920px..
Basically like this:
1) Page width (in properties): 7680 (this will cater for 4 pages)
2) Place the first bookmark at the far top-left hand side, then go across the width to 1920 and place another bookmark and so on
3) Basically what this will do is, users who have a resolution of 1920x1080 on a large monitor will not see the content on screen from the second page/second bookmark
4) Always aim to build the page content with around 970px width (place a shape object with 970px at the top point of your bookmaks so you know your workspace)
5) and...dont forget to set the overflow-x to hidden in the page properties under misc to give it that x-factor
ps. yes set the direction to: horizontal in the UPS extension properties.

IeMS wrote:Scott,
Thank you for this information. I will give it a try. Can you tell me what the visitor experience will be if they have a more narrow screen - like a 19" or 17"? Smaller resolution?
Also, what are you recommendations for vertical scrolling?
Building sites at 970 width (centered) is the first thing that I learned using this software. That is what my site is set to and it fits nicely in smartphones (landscape).
"and...dont forget to set the overflow-x to hidden in the page properties under misc to give it that x-factor" - what does this do?
Thank you again.
Hi Rob,
There will be no difference really in what resolution the user uses, the only difference would be the amount of time it scrolls but if you set it pretty quick, lets say 800 all should be fine.
you're spot on with the 970px
The overflow-x set to hidden - this will make the scrollbars across the bottom (of a horizontal scrolling website) dissapear, giving a more pro aproach to this style of website.
As for a vertical scrolling website - This is standard procedure really, it just depends on your style/taste, i would normally keep a work area content of around 500px-600px vertically.
